The reclaimed wood construction provides structural rigidity and an approachable appearance suited to public service areas. Customers will perceive a crafted presentation while staff benefit from a durable unit that withstands repeated handling.
#@@# Revolving Access#@#
A revolving mechanism allows operators to rotate compartments toward the service point, reducing reach time and improving workflow. Teams can maintain service tempo during peak periods by bringing the required compartment to the front without moving the entire unit.
#@@# Four Compartments#@#
Four dedicated sections separate cups, lids, and accessories to prevent cross-contamination and speed selection. Staff can assign specific positions for sizes or types to standardize organization across shifts.
#@@# Compact Footprint#@#
Measuring 9 inches wide by 9 inches deep and 18.5 inches high, the unit fits narrow counters and limited shelving without sacrificing capacity. Facilities with constrained space retain necessary supplies within arm’s reach while preserving usable countertop area.
#@@# Capacity Handling#@#
The organizer accommodates items up to 3-3/4 inches in diameter and holds an estimated 2.05 gallons in volume across compartments, supporting moderate traffic points. Managers can plan restock intervals with predictable fill rates, reducing last-minute supply runs.
#@@# Service Durability#@#
A 22-pound build weight and solid joinery deliver stability under repeated loading and rotation, minimizing tip risk during handling.
